[6/9] sstatesig/find_siginfo: unify a disjointed API

find_siginfo() returns two different data structures depending
on whether its third argument (list of hashes to find) is empty or
not:
- a dict of timestamps keyed by path
- a dict of paths keyed by hash

This is not a good API design; it's much better to return
a dict of dicts that include both timestamp and path, keyed by
hash. Then the API consumer can decide how they want to use these
fields, particularly for additional diagnostics or informational
output.

I also took the opportunity to add a binary field that
tells if the match came from sstate or local stamps dir, which
will help prioritize local stamps when looking up most
recent task signatures.
